  5. FORTRESS FALLS TO RED ONSLAUGHT

    PARIS, Friday.--M. Joseph Laniel, French Prime Minister, announced in the French Assembly today, the fall of Dien Bien Phu, after 20 hours' continuous fighting. The central redoubt had fallen, although the isolated strongpoint "Isabel", to the ...

  7. BANNISTER BREAKS FOUR MINUTE MILE

    LONDON, Friday.--Roger Bannister, lanky English athlete yesterday became the first man in the world to run the mile in under four minutes--a feat many doctors and sportsmen believed impossible. Bannister, a 24-year-old medical student, collapsed and had to be ... [ILLUSTRATED]
